― A Quick Q+A ―

What Type of Venue is "The Lavish Brew"?
The Lavish Brew is a semi-traditional Ishgardian tea shop located in the city, itself!
While it's in-game location is currently in the Empyreum, its actual IC location is in the backroads of the Pillars. It's just a short stroll from the Jeweled Crozier.
The shop itself is over thirty years old. While it slowly grew to become a successful business, it was unfortunately forced to close its doors following the Calamity. Recently, it has gained a new owner and has opened to the public once more after a long period of repairs and renovations. Lady Lissette, the current owner and niece of the original founder, would love to tell you more of The Lavish Brew's history should the topic be brought up.
